Noun: submitter
  1. Someone who yields to the will of another person or force
  2. Someone who submits something (as an application for a job or a manuscript for publication etc.) for the judgment of others
    "he was a prolific submitter of proposals"

Derived forms: submitters

Type of: acolyte, applicant, applier, follower

